End of Buddhist lent


 The time wewere in Thailand, was also the time that Khao Pansaa or the end of the Buddhist lent was celebrated.
The buddist lent starts with the rainy season and goes on for almost 3 months. It is the time for solitude. Monks do not travel between temples and spent a lot of time meditating and learning.
This is also a favourite time for many male Thais to go into the temple. Normally every male has spent a period of time in the gtezmple in his life. 




We also went one time to the temple to pay our respect and bring food for the monks. Our local temple is not big or rich and not so many people were there.
